A Mendocino motor is a fascinating demonstration model that combines solar power with magnetic levitation. Built with solar silicon wafers, copper coils, a rotating shaft, NdFeB magnets, and a sturdy acrylic frame, it represents the perfect blend of science, engineering, and design. . Solar paint, also known as photovoltaic paint, is a liquid coating that can capture energy from sunlight and convert it into electricity – similar to how traditional solar panels work, but in a paint-like form. This type of paint is flexible, possibly cheaper than panels, and may bring clean energy to areas. . There are three types of solar paint: quantum dot solar cells, hydrogen-producing solar paint, and perovskite solar paint. It typically employs a slurry of semiconductor nanoparticles, such as perovskites, quantum dots, or copper indium gallium selenide (CIGS), suspended in a liquid solution.
